Educational Visits 101…for providers
A must-attend course for anyone working in sales and support for educational visits.
Your essential introduction to educational visits roles and responsibilities for staff in schools; the legal and guidance framework; risk assessment requirements; approval processes and systems.

Educational Visits 101 for Providers will cover all this and more. You’ll examine school staff responsibilities around risk management, approvals, reporting, and evaluation, helping you to identify ways you can better support your school clients.
Better informed. Better able to support.
You’ll learn about waivers, contracts and consent, and find out what (and why) schools need to check about providers, including where the LOtC Quality Badge and provider forms fit in.
We’ll also take a look inside the EVOLVE system, where you’ll get a ‘schools-eye view’ of the risk-management and approvals process. You’ll see where your organisation sits within EVOLVE and Kaddi, and explore opportunities to raise your profile.

Who should attend?
Educational Visits 101 is designed for sales and support team colleagues at providers, tour operators and other companies involved in school travel. It is also suitable for marketing teams, team leaders and anyone new to the educational visits sector.

About this course
EVOLVE Advice has created this course to help providers upskill new and frontline staff, and to bridge a gap between schools and providers, helping ensure that more children and young people experience safe and memorable educational visits
As Educational Visits Advisers, we are in a unique position to train your teams on the risk management side of educational visits. Working with a community of around 3,000 schools of all shapes and sizes, we can provide insight into the day to day reality of the EVC and Visit Leader role and help you work more effectively with your clients.
